网上现有很多记录ubuntu系统密码正确但是进不去的文章,里面方法均是基于tty模式终端进行操作。由于我这次的错误导致tty模式也不能用,解决了将近6个小时。因此记录一下。
问题来源:手工不小心 Kill 了/usr/lib/xorg/Xorg进程,电脑重启后,输入密码进不去桌面,tty模式下也登录不进去。
解决方法:
第一步:找到可以输入命令的地方(recovery mode)。电脑启动按住ESC(我的是华硕主板,有的是按Shift)显示启动界面-->选择*Advance options for ubuntu-->选择你所使用的内核的xxxxx(recovery mode)->选择root。PS:Recovery Menu里面每一项都有自己的功能,可以看网页https://blog.csdn.net/qq_36786467/article/details/108156413学习一下。
第二步:在root下,vim .xsession-errors,查看一下里面报的错误,然后依据错误,搜方法进行解决。
PS: 我的错误是:openConnection: connect: No such file or directory cannot connect to brltty at :0。解决方法:mv ~/.config/dconf/user ~/.config/dconf/user.old
在查看xsession-errors文件之前,我还尝试了https://www.itdaan.com/blog/2013/12/08/c42e3b1e95f411ffcb4e3c7ea40c0492.html。其实最后也不知道是那种方法有效的。。。